A bottom casing packoff is a device used in drilling and completion operations that seals the annular space between the casing and the wellbore at the bottom of the well, preventing fluid migration and ensuring pressure integrity.

In the field of oil and gas drilling, various components play crucial roles in ensuring the efficiency and safety of operations. One such component is the bottom casing packoff, which serves as a vital barrier within the wellbore. Understanding the function and importance of this device is essential for professionals in the industry. The bottom casing packoff is designed to seal the annular space between the casing and the formation at the bottom of the well. This sealing function is critical for preventing fluid migration, which can lead to contamination of the reservoir and other operational issues. By maintaining a secure seal, the bottom casing packoff helps to protect the integrity of the well and ensures that drilling fluids remain contained during the drilling process.The installation of the bottom casing packoff occurs after the casing has been set in place. It is typically made from durable materials that can withstand high pressures and temperatures found deep within the earth. The effectiveness of the bottom casing packoff is contingent upon proper installation and the quality of materials used. A poorly installed packoff can result in significant problems, including blowouts or loss of control over the well. Therefore, rigorous testing and adherence to industry standards are paramount during the installation process.Moreover, the bottom casing packoff plays a critical role during completion and production phases of the well. Once the well is drilled and the casing is cemented, the packoff provides a reliable barrier that allows for safe production operations. It prevents any unwanted influx of fluids from surrounding formations, thus ensuring that the produced hydrocarbons can flow freely to the surface without contamination. This function is not only vital for operational efficiency but also for environmental safety, as it minimizes the risk of spills and leaks.In addition, advancements in technology have led to the development of more sophisticated bottom casing packoff systems. These modern packoffs are often equipped with features that enhance their sealing capabilities and make them easier to install and remove. For instance, some designs incorporate expandable elements that can adapt to variations in wellbore conditions, providing a tighter seal and improving overall performance.
